Today, I wanted to share with the MFP community my first mini achievement during my journey of weight loss. I started trying to lose weight in late March when I touched 203lb. I found MFP, and although I did not yet start logging my activities here, I started reading the motivation and support forum and couple other forum threads diligently. In one of those threads, there was a mention that the goal for losing weight should not be losing weight but should be supplemented by a secondary goal, something that would lead to weightloss during the process of achieving that goal. This motivated me to take the next step and face my nemesis, running. I said to myself in January that I will run a marathon by end of the year.

I started off slow, running less than half mile for over a week, and then slowly graduated to running my first mile after 1 month. Then added half mile every week, till I reached 3 miles. I started running 5 times a day. Slowly I increased my weekly run distance till I felt comfortable running upto 6 miles in a single go. It definitely was not easy. I braved rain, torrid heat and a few times, some of the most pleasant evening weather I have ever enjoyed.

This weekend, I finally ran my first half marathon. It is a first mini achievement. The time was horrible. I crossed finish line at 2:35. But I achieved running continuously without walking (except during one or 2 water breaks) and finishing my last 1.5 miles faster than any other distance throughout the run.

During the process, I have lost 22 lb's. I still have ways to go (I am now 181 but I need to be at 150-155 to get better at running, I am 5'9), but slowly the progress is showing.
